The German A8 Treffen sadly isn't taking place this year either, so we have taken it upon ourselves to organise a road trip in September instead, taking in the two greatest racing circuits in the world: Spa Francorchamps, and the Nurburgring. Not just visiting, but driving them both :cool: The trip will start on Monday the 19th of September where we will catch a ferry from Dover to Calais, and make our way to a hotel (tbc) near the Spa Francorchamps circuit. Tuesday the 20th starts with a leisurely breakfast and then we head to the circuit for the Public Driving Experience. This is a public open-track day for road cars only - no timing, no slicks, no racecars, be sensible, go at your own pace. Mike and I are booked in Pack C which starts at 11:30, to allow for late arrival on the Monday. This comprises four 25 minute sessions split roughly an hour apart, for €319. Alternatively, there is a single run of 25 minutes at 16:00 which is €100. http://forum.a8parts.co.uk/attachmen...1&d=1651847277 From here we then have three days of touristing - a Schloss or two, likely a Rhine valley vineyard and wine tasting, and hopefully a trip North to catch up with Vera and Dean. There's a great handbag shop along the front here, and the castle does excellent cake, although its a bit of a hike up there. http://forum.a8parts.co.uk/attachmen...1&d=1651847277 After touristing, we head to the Nürburgring for the weekend Tourist Drives sessions. Given my history of the track being closed whenever I go there, we're allowing Saturday and Sunday for track time. I'm planning to get out very early for the first laps on one or both days while the track is quiet, as currently it is expected to be open from 08:00 - 19:00. It is likely to get quite busy during the day. Each lap of the 'ring is €30 and you can buy as many as you like. http://forum.a8parts.co.uk/attachmen...1&d=1651847277 We plan on finding something else to do during the busy times on Saturday as well, so its not all going to be track time (unless you want to). There are lots of places to eat in the area, and spectating areas if you fancy that. There is also Nürburg Castle to explore nearby. http://forum.a8parts.co.uk/attachmen...1&d=1651847277 Sunday morning may well see a few more laps of the circuit, and then we'll set off mid-late morning for the sprint home, expecting to be back late Sunday night. We had a great time. +++
Spa Francorchamps was epic until my NS front wheel bolts came loose on the forth pace car lap which caused me to pit and loose the run. I had had 18 laps by then over 3 25 minute sessions. I'm sure MJ and Darren will pop on with their thoughts idc. I will try to upload some video for streaming. I have 2 runs for Spa and 1 wet lap of the ring. The Ring was a bit of a come down after Spa. It was absolutely rammed on the Friday evening and Saturday and on Saturday afternoon it rained! We arrived for the Friday evening to find huge queues and within 45 minutes the track was red flagged for an hour so we tootled off to our accommodation. Back Saturday morning and after extended queueing I got two laps in but there were multiple yellow flags due to crashes and the track was closed again by lunch time! Rained in the afternoon but went back for a wet lap which had no yellow flags but we were held up by slow BMWs and Porsches! the good bits turned into a bit of a procession. :tuttut: Sunday morning for one last blast arriving at 8am to find the track closed due to fog! So back to the hotels and pack up and one last attempt at 10am to find it was still closed! Ferries and tides wait for no man so we headed home. Still very enjoyable though. :) |
